Searched refs:PtrSize (Results 1 - 16 of 16) sorted by relevance

/freebsd-12-stable/contrib/llvm-project/clang/lib/AST/
H A DMicrosoftCXXABI.cpp240 unsigned PtrSize = Target.getPointerWidth(0); local
247 MPI.Width = Ptrs * PtrSize + Ints * IntSize;
261 MPI.HasPadding = MPI.Width != (Ptrs * PtrSize + Ints * IntSize);
H A DASTContext.cpp6501 CharUnits PtrSize = getTypeSizeInChars(VoidPtrTy); local
6502 CharUnits ParmOffset = PtrSize;
6517 ParmOffset = PtrSize;
6609 CharUnits PtrSize = getTypeSizeInChars(VoidPtrTy); local
6612 CharUnits ParmOffset = 2 * PtrSize;
6626 S += charUnitsToString(PtrSize);
6629 ParmOffset = 2 * PtrSize;
H A DExprConstant.cpp11931 unsigned PtrSize = Info.Ctx.getTypeSize(LHSTy);
11934 assert(PtrSize <= 64 && "Unexpected pointer width");
11935 uint64_t Mask = ~0ULL >> (64 - PtrSize);
/freebsd-12-stable/contrib/llvm-project/llvm/lib/Target/AArch64/
H A DAArch64LegalizerInfo.cpp708 unsigned PtrSize = ValTy.getElementType().getSizeInBits(); local
709 const LLT NewTy = LLT::vector(ValTy.getNumElements(), PtrSize);
735 const unsigned PtrSize = PtrTy.getSizeInBits() / 8; local
740 PtrSize, /* Align = */ PtrSize));
743 if (Align > PtrSize) {
758 ValSize, std::max(Align, PtrSize)));
760 auto Size = MIRBuilder.buildConstant(IntPtrTy, alignTo(ValSize, PtrSize));
767 PtrSize, /* Align = */ PtrSize));
[all...]
H A DAArch64ISelLowering.cpp5713 unsigned PtrSize = Subtarget->isTargetILP32() ? 4 : 8; local
5715 Subtarget->isTargetWindows()) ? PtrSize : 32;
5720 DAG.getConstant(VaListSize, DL, MVT::i32), PtrSize,
/freebsd-12-stable/contrib/llvm-project/llvm/lib/IR/
H A DMangler.cpp104 unsigned PtrSize = DL.getPointerSize(); local
105 ArgWords += alignTo(DL.getTypeAllocSize(Ty), PtrSize);
H A DInstructions.cpp2646 unsigned PtrSize = SrcIntPtrTy->getScalarSizeInBits(); local
2647 if (MidSize >= PtrSize)
2667 // inttoptr, ptrtoint -> bitcast if SrcSize<=PtrSize and SrcSize==DstSize
2670 unsigned PtrSize = MidIntPtrTy->getScalarSizeInBits(); local
2673 if (SrcSize <= PtrSize && SrcSize == DstSize)
/freebsd-12-stable/contrib/llvm-project/llvm/lib/ExecutionEngine/
H A DExecutionEngine.cpp342 unsigned PtrSize = EE->getDataLayout().getPointerSize(); local
343 Array = std::make_unique<char[]>((InputArgv.size()+1)*PtrSize);
359 (GenericValue*)(&Array[i*PtrSize]), SBytePtr);
365 (GenericValue*)(&Array[InputArgv.size()*PtrSize]),
418 unsigned PtrSize = EE->getDataLayout().getPointerSize(); local
419 for (unsigned i = 0; i < PtrSize; ++i)
/freebsd-12-stable/contrib/llvm-project/llvm/lib/CodeGen/AsmPrinter/
H A DDwarfDebug.cpp2188 unsigned PtrSize = Asm->MAI->getCodePointerSize();
2191 Asm->getDataLayout().isLittleEndian(), PtrSize);
2192 DWARFExpression Expr(Data, getDwarfVersion(), PtrSize);
2629 unsigned PtrSize = Asm->MAI->getCodePointerSize();
2658 unsigned TupleSize = PtrSize * 2;
2675 Asm->emitInt8(PtrSize);
2682 Asm->EmitLabelReference(Span.Start, PtrSize);
2686 Asm->EmitLabelDifference(Span.End, Span.Start, PtrSize);
2694 Asm->OutStreamer->EmitIntValue(Size, PtrSize);
2699 Asm->OutStreamer->EmitIntValue(0, PtrSize);
[all...]
H A DAsmPrinter.cpp616 unsigned PtrSize = DL.getPointerTypeSize(GV->getType()); local
618 PtrSize);
619 OutStreamer->EmitIntValue(0, PtrSize);
620 OutStreamer->EmitSymbolValue(MangSym, PtrSize);
1569 unsigned PtrSize = MAI->getCodePointerSize(); local
1571 PtrSize);
/freebsd-12-stable/contrib/llvm-project/llvm/lib/Target/AMDGPU/
H A DAMDGPURegisterBankInfo.cpp518 unsigned PtrSize = PtrTy.getSizeInBits(); local
528 AMDGPU::getValueMapping(AMDGPU::SGPRRegBankID, PtrSize)}),
536 AMDGPU::getValueMapping(AMDGPU::VGPRRegBankID, PtrSize)}),
2359 unsigned PtrSize = PtrTy.getSizeInBits(); local
2372 PtrMapping = AMDGPU::getValueMapping(AMDGPU::SGPRRegBankID, PtrSize);
2375 PtrMapping = AMDGPU::getValueMapping(AMDGPU::VGPRRegBankID, PtrSize);
/freebsd-12-stable/contrib/llvm-project/llvm/lib/ExecutionEngine/Interpreter/
H A DExecution.cpp1532 uint32_t PtrSize = getDataLayout().getPointerSizeInBits();
1533 if (PtrSize != Src.IntVal.getBitWidth())
1534 Src.IntVal = Src.IntVal.zextOrTrunc(PtrSize);
/freebsd-12-stable/contrib/llvm-project/clang/lib/CodeGen/
H A DCGClass.cpp767 unsigned PtrSize = CGM.getDataLayout().getPointerSizeInBits(); local
812 F, {Builder.CreateAdd(ThisPtr, Builder.getIntN(PtrSize, EndOffset)),
813 Builder.getIntN(PtrSize, PoisonSize)});
/freebsd-12-stable/contrib/llvm-project/llvm/lib/Target/Mips/
H A DMipsISelLowering.cpp2154 unsigned PtrSize = PtrVT.getSizeInBits(); local
2155 IntegerType *PtrTy = Type::getIntNTy(*DAG.getContext(), PtrSize);
/freebsd-12-stable/contrib/llvm-project/llvm/lib/Transforms/InstCombine/
H A DInstCombineCompares.cpp315 unsigned PtrSize = IntPtrTy->getIntegerBitWidth(); local
316 if (Idx->getType()->getPrimitiveSizeInBits() > PtrSize)
/freebsd-12-stable/contrib/llvm-project/llvm/lib/CodeGen/SelectionDAG/
H A DTargetLowering.cpp4330 unsigned PtrSize = DL.getPointerSizeInBits(PT->getAddressSpace()); local
4331 OpInfo.ConstraintVT = MVT::getIntegerVT(PtrSize);

Completed in 573 milliseconds